Planswift Integration

Copper Contributor

I'm using a takeoff software, Planswift. It allows me to integrate into Microsoft Excel, It only happened once where I was able to see the planswift information in excel. I have no idea how to get it to show again. Its supposed to be showing up in the ribbon tabs

 

This is from planswift.

 

300 Quick Reference Ribbon Bar.png

 

Planswift has a button in the software that allows the integration, I've done everything I can think of to try to get this to show up. 

 

Does anyone have any suggestions?

Select File > Options.

Select Add-ins in the navigation pane on the left.

 

Do you see Planswift in the list of Inactive Application Add-ins?

If so, note its type (Excel Add-in or COM Add-in).

Select that type in the Manage drop-down near the bottom, then click Go...

Tick the check box for Planswift, then OK your way out.

Does that restore the Planswift tab?

 

If you see Planswift in the list of Active Application Add-ins, follow the steps described above, but clear the check box. Then follow them again, and tick the check box.

If that doesn't help, you should reinstall the Planswift add-in.

 

If you see Planswift in the list of Disabled Application Add-ins (you may have to scroll to the bottom of the list), select Disabled Items from the Manage drop-down and click Go...

Select Planswift and click Enable.

 

If none of the above options apply, you should reinstall Planswift.
